What is Monocle 3.5?

Monocle 3.5 is a macOS utility that minimizes visual clutter by blurring background windows, allowing users to focus exclusively on their active task. Think of it as noise-cancelling headphones, but for your screen.

Why Founders Need It

Founders often manage high-context tasks while navigating a graveyard of open browser tabs, design files, and communication tools. By isolating the active window, Monocle reduces cognitive load and helps maintain flow state in an increasingly fragmented digital environment.

Key Features

  • App Groups: Keep entire workflows (e.g., Slack, Chrome, and Notion) in focus together.
  • Deep Customization: Adjust blur intensity, add tints, or apply grain effects to suit your workspace aesthetic.
  • Native Integration: Supports macOS Stage Manager and multi-monitor setups.
  • Performance-Focused: Rebuilt rendering engine ensures minimal CPU impact during idle states.

Pricing and Availability

Monocle offers a 7-day free trial. Licenses are available as a one-time purchase: $9 for a single license or $25 for a 3-seat multi-license, with periodic promotional discounts.

Vs. Alternatives

While tools like HazeOver and HokusFocus offer similar dimming features, Monocle differentiates itself through deep OS integration and its focus on multi-window/multi-monitor workflows.
